What is P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k Return-on-Tangible-Equity?

P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k ISX:AMFG +1.99% 56 Return-on-Tangible-Equity is -0.20% as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ates ISX:AMFG with a GF Score™ of 56/100 and a GF Value™ of Rp4,169.39 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 5 warning signs investors should review. Among 397 Building Materials companies, P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k ranks worse than 70.78% on this metric.

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ated as Net Income divided by its average total shareholder tangible equity. Total shareholder tangible equity equals to Total Stockholders Equity minus Intangible Assets. P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k's annualized net income for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was Rp-9,040 Mil. P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k's average shareholder tangible equity for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was Rp4,557,314 Mil. Therefore, P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Equity for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was -0.20%.

P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k  (ISX:AMFG)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k Business Description

Address Jalan Ancol IX No. 5, Ancol Barat, North Jakarta, IDN, 14430
PT Asahimas Flat Glass Tbk is a glass manufacturing company. The company is also engaged in import export and glass quality testing laboratory services. The company operates in two segments namely flat glass and automotive glass. Its portfolio of the company consists of various glasses such as tinted glass, figured glass, reflective glass, mirror glass, tempered glass, and laminated glass. Its business activity of the organization functions in the geographical areas of Indonesia which include Jakarta, Cikampek, and Sidoarjo. It generates revenue through the sale of glass products.
